#d5843f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d5843f is composed of 83.5% red, 51.8%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38% magenta, 70.4%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 27.6 degrees, a saturation of 64.1% and a lightness of 54.1%. #d5843f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ff7e with #ab0900.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

● #d5843f color description : Moderate orange.
#d5843f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d5843f has RGB values of R:213, G:132, B:63 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.38, Y:0.7,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 13993023.

Shades and Tints of #d5843f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#fcf5f0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d5843f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d8a87 is the less saturated color, while #f9811b is the most saturated one.
